Jackass Hostel, nestled in a charming small town, serves as an excellent base for nature enthusiasts and adventurers aiming to explore the beauty of Yosemite and Sequoia National Parks. Surrounded by natural splendor and conveniently located near shops and restaurants, the hostel offers a serene and accessible setting for exploration. While the journey to some park areas may be extended, the scenic drive is considered worthwhile.
The hostel receives exceptional praise for its spotless cleanliness, with amenities and bathrooms often likened to those found in higher-star accommodations. Despite the absence of air conditioning, the environment remains cozy and comfortable, ensuring a pleasant stay. The attentive hosts contribute significantly to the warm and welcoming atmosphere, enhancing the homely feel.
Guests consistently applaud the hostel staff for their exemplary service, noting the responsive and friendly nature of the hosts, Heather and Kim. Their proactive engagement and thoughtfulness foster a familiar and inviting ambiance, whether it involves offering advice on hikes or checking in with guests to ensure satisfaction.
While the hostel thrives in many areas, opinions on the beds vary. Cleanliness and quality are appreciated, yet some guests find them uncomfortable, with critiques on noise and size, particularly the bunk beds for taller individuals. Nonetheless, the overall cozy and hospitable environment often leads guests to overlook these minor inconveniences, making Jackass Hostel a favored choice for those seeking a comfortable and engaging stay.
